Chrysaor drills dry well in North Sea
The well was drilled 26 km south of the Sleipner Øst installation and 9 km south of the Grevling discovery in the North Sea, about 240 km west of Stavanger.
ASCO to provide logistics and supply base services for North Sea development
The 20-month contract will see ASCO service the IOG's five-well development of the Southwark, Blythe and Elgood fields via its Great Yarmouth hub.
Actemium and Semco Maritime given commissioning services contract for Tyra redevelopment project
The companies' work scope as part of the installion of eight new platforms at the Tyra field includes project management, HSE management, planning, commissioning engineering, onshore sail away preparation from the fabrication yards, offshore commissioning execution, procurement and subcontracting as well as start-up assistance.
Maersk Drilling divests jack-ups to New Fortress Energy
New Fortress Energy will use the Maersk Guardian and Mærsk Gallant rigs for non-drilling purposes as part of their planned Fast LNG project.

OGTC to invest £1 million in scaling up hydrogen technologies for North Sea decarbonisation
Submissions to the Call for Ideas must focus on technologies that will decarbonise offshore operations and help the UK become the world’s first net zero basin.
IOG to support CCS research
IOG will support research into carbon capture and storage and other renewable opportunities across its asset portfolio broader Bacton catchment area in the UK Southern North Sea.
Quenguela drillship secures twelve well contract offshore Angola
Sonadrill has secured a twelve well contract with one option for nine wells and eleven one well options in Angola for the Sonangol Quenguela drillship.
NOV awarded STP system contract by BW Offshore
The company will supply a large submerged turret production system for an FPSO that will operate in the Barossa gas and condensate field located offshore of Australia.
Shearwater GeoServices awarded Campos Basin 3D and 4D programmes by Petrobras
The 3D and 4D programmes will be conducted over 9 months by the SW Empress, over the Marlim, Albacora and Voador fields, starting in late 2Q21.
